1. A semiconductor device comprising:

  • a semiconductor substrate of a first conductivity type;

    a plurality of trench portions selectively formed on a main surface of said semiconductor substrate, each trench portion having bottom and side surfaces;

    a plurality of impurity regions of a second conductivity type formed in the semiconductor substrate, each impurity region provided corresponding to said plurality of trench portions, respectively, and extending from said main surface deeper than the bottom surface of said corresponding trench portion and being in contact with at least said bottom surface of said corresponding trench portion; and

    a first electrode layer formed on said main surface of said semiconductor substrate, said first electrode layer being in electrical contact with said main surface and at least a portion of each impurity region at said main surface, wherein each of said impurity regions has an impurity concentration lower than a minimum impurity concentration for enabling an ohmic contact with said first electrode layer except for portions having a minimum impurity concentration for enabling an ohmic contact with said first electrode at said main surface near said side surfaces, said first electrode and each impurity region form an ohmic contact at a contact region between said first electrode and at least a portion of each impurity region at said main surface near said side surfaces of its corresponding trench portion, and said first electrode and said semiconductor substrate form a Schottky junction region at the main surface of said semiconductor substrate except for said contact region between said first electrode and said impurity regions.
